East Mansfield Neighborhood Overview
East Mansfield: A Premier Brockton Enclave
East Mansfield stands as one of Brockton's most distinguished and affluent neighborhoods, characterized by its spacious, tree-lined streets, well-maintained properties, and a palpable sense of established community. This area, situated in the northeastern quadrant of the city, benefits from a location that feels distinctly suburban while maintaining convenient access to Brockton's core amenities and major transportation corridors like Route 24 and Route 27. The neighborhood's name and aesthetic draw from its proximity to the town of Mansfield, offering a similar serene and upscale residential feel within the city limits.
Historically, East Mansfield evolved from Brockton's expansion beyond its dense urban center, attracting professionals and families seeking larger lots and a quieter lifestyle. The development pattern reflects post-war growth through the late 20th century, resulting in a mature landscape with towering trees and settled infrastructure. Today, East Mansfield is often perceived as Brockton's premier residential address, known for its high property values, excellent public services, and a community invested in preserving its distinctive character and quality of life.
Housing & Real Estate
The housing stock in East Mansfield is predominantly composed of single-family homes, with a strong emphasis on classic New England architectural styles. Residents will find a collection of expansive Colonials, Capes, and raised ranches, many constructed from the 1960s through the 1990s, situated on generous, landscaped lots often exceeding a quarter-acre. The median home value of $540,100 significantly outpaces both the Brockton citywide and regional averages, positioning the neighborhood in the upper echelon of the local market. Price ranges typically span from the mid-$400,000s for well-kept, modest-sized homes to over $700,000 for larger, updated estates with premium finishes and amenities.
East Mansfield exhibits a high rate of homeownership, aligning with its stable, family-oriented demographic. The rental market is limited, primarily consisting of accessory units or the occasional turnover of older homes. Recent trends show sustained demand, with properties in this submarket often receiving multiple offers and selling relatively quickly due to the neighborhood's coveted status. Renovations and updates are common, as new buyers seek to modernize floor plans and systems while maintaining the area's traditional exterior charm.
Lifestyle & Amenities
Residents of East Mansfield enjoy a lifestyle centered on suburban comfort and convenience. While primarily a residential district, it is within a short drive of diverse shopping and dining options. The Westgate Mall plaza and surrounding retail corridors on Belmont Street and Route 27 provide everyday necessities, supermarkets, and a variety of casual and mid-range restaurants. For more upscale dining and boutique shopping, residents often travel to adjacent communities like Stoughton or to the South Shore Plaza area.
The neighborhood is well-served by green spaces, including the expansive D.W. Field Park, a 700-acre municipal park offering walking and biking trails, golf, fishing, and scenic drives at its doorstep. Walkability within the neighborhood itself is moderate, with quiet streets ideal for jogging and dog walking, but most errands require a vehicle. Public transit is accessed via Brockton Area Transit (BAT) bus lines along major thoroughfares, providing connectivity to downtown Brockton and the Brockton commuter rail station for direct service to Boston.
Schools & Education
East Mansfield is served by the Brockton Public Schools district, with students typically zoned for some of the city's highest-performing schools, which is a significant driver of the area's real estate appeal. The specific elementary schools, such as the Angelo School, are well-regarded and benefit from strong parental involvement. Students generally progress to the highly acclaimed East Middle School and subsequently to Brockton High School, a large, nationally recognized school with extensive academic, athletic, and arts programs, including Advanced Placement and International Baccalaureate pathways.
In addition to the strong public offerings, the neighborhood's demographic profile supports a variety of private educational options. Several respected parochial and independent schools are located within a reasonable commute in Brockton and surrounding towns. The area's high median income also indicates a community that highly values educational attainment, with many households investing in supplemental educational resources and activities for their children.
Community & Demographics
East Mansfield is defined by its affluent, family-centric, and professionally accomplished demographic. With a median household income of $125,506—nearly double the Brockton city median—the neighborhood is a hub for executives, healthcare professionals, educators, and other white-collar occupations. The population is a diverse mix, with a significant representation of multi-generational families, long-term residents who have appreciated the area's stability, and newer buyers attracted by its reputation.
The age distribution skews toward established adults and school-age children, with a lower proportion of young singles or seniors compared to other parts of the city. The community character is one of quiet pride and civic engagement, with residents actively participating in local schools, neighborhood associations, and city affairs. This engagement fosters a secure, neighborly environment where property standards are high, and community ties are strong, contributing to the area's enduring desirability and low turnover.
